Manufacturer Capacity:
 

CapacityDouble Sided: 12000 sq.m / month
Multilayers: 8000sq.m / month
Min Line Width/Gap4/4 mil (1mil=0.0254mm)
Board Thickness0.3~4.0mm
Layers1~20 layers
MaterialFR-4, Aluminum, PI
Copper Thickness0.5~4oz
Material TgTg140~Tg170
Max PCB Size600*1200mm
Min Hole Size0.2mm (+/- 0.025)
Surface TreatmentHASL, ENIG, OSP

A few additional points related to quick turn PCB assembly:

 

Design Verification: Before proceeding with quick turn PCB assembly, it's important to verify the design for any potential issues or errors. This can be done through design rule checks (DRC) and simulation tools to catch any design flaws that could cause delays during assembly.

Expedited Prototyping: Quick turn PCB assembly is often used for rapid prototyping purposes. It allows designers and engineers to quickly iterate and refine their designs by manufacturing and assembling multiple prototypes in a short timeframe. This accelerated prototyping process enables faster product development cycles.

Agile Supply Chain: A well-established and agile supply chain is crucial for quick turn PCB assembly. This involves maintaining close relationships with reliable component suppliers, distributors, and PCB fabrication services that specialize in fast turnaround times. Having a network of trusted partners helps ensure the availability of components and fast PCB fabrication when needed.

Design Simplification: To expedite the assembly process, it can be beneficial to simplify the design where possible. This includes reducing the number of components, minimizing the complexity of the PCB layout, and optimizing for efficient assembly processes. A simplified design can lead to faster assembly and reduce the likelihood of errors or rework.

Concurrent Engineering: Quick turn PCB assembly often involves close collaboration between design engineers and assembly manufacturers. By involving the manufacturer early in the design process, potential manufacturing issues can be addressed upfront, streamlining the assembly process and minimizing delays.

Agile Project Management: Effective project management is essential for quick turn PCB assembly. This includes closely tracking the progress of each stage of the assembly process, coordinating activities between different teams or suppliers, and promptly addressing any bottlenecks or challenges that may arise. Agile project management methodologies can be employed to ensure efficient execution.

Expedited Delivery: Once the PCB assembly is completed, expedited shipping or delivery methods are used to ensure the fast delivery of the assembled PCBs to the customer. This may involve using express courier services or coordinating with logistics partners to meet tight delivery timelines.

Quick turn PCB assembly plays a vital role in accelerating product development cycles, enabling faster time-to-market, and meeting urgent project requirements. It requires a well-coordinated effort between designers, manufacturers, and suppliers to ensure efficient and timely delivery of high-quality PCB assemblies.
